Compartilhar via


@microsoft/sp-component-base package

Estrutura do SharePoint suporte para a criação de componentes do lado do cliente

Classes

BaseComponent

A classe base para componentes do lado do cliente, como BaseClientSideWebPart ou BaseExtension.

BaseComponentContext

A classe base para objetos de contexto para componentes do lado do cliente.

DynamicDataProvider

O Fornecedor de Dados Dinâmicos permite que os componentes consumam Dados Dinâmicos. Permite que os componentes solicitem origens de Dados Dinâmicos e registem/anulem o registo dessas origens.

DynamicDataSourceManager

O Gestor de Origens de Dados Dinâmico é responsável por: - Construir a origem de dados dinâmica – permitir a inicialização da origem de dados dinâmica por um componente – Permitir que a origem de dados atualize os metadados e notifique quando os dados forem atualizados.

DynamicProperty

Objeto serializável que simplifica a utilização de uma DynamicProperty.

ThemeChangedEventArgs

O objeto foi transmitido quando o IThemeProvider.themeChangedEvent é gerado.

ThemeProvider

A classe ThemeProvider fornece a capacidade de obter temas diferentes do Framework. Os temas podem ser fornecidos em diferentes contextos, por exemplo, as secções de tela podem fornecer uma variante do tema global em alguns contextos.

Interfaces

IComponentPropertyMetadata

Esta é a estrutura utilizada para valores de mapa para metadados de propriedades do componente.

IReadonlyFontStyles
IReadonlyTheme

Imutável ITheme.

ISerializedServerProcessedData

Contém conjuntos de dados que podem ser processados pelos serviços do lado do servidor como o índice de pesquisas e a correção de links

ITheme

Coleção de valores de tema, que podem ser utilizados para componentes de estilo programaticamente.

Aliases de tipo

IReadonlyRawStyle